[0018] Examples, see figure 1 , figure 2 , image 3 and Fig. 4, a mixed waste combustion waste heat power generation system of the present invention, including a dryer, an extrusion and chopping heating device 2, a cooling tower 3, a mixer 4 and a power generation device 5, the power generation device 5 is provided with a steam exhaust mouth, water inlet and feed inlet, the drying machine and the extruding and chopping heating device 2 are respectively provided with heating pipes 28, and the steam exhaust ports are respectively connected with the heating pipes 28 through pipelines, and the heating pipes 28 It is connected to the cooling tower 3 through pipelines, and the cooling tower 3 is connected to the water inlet through pipelines. A conveyer belt is arranged between the dryer and the extruding and chopping heating device 2. Abstract

The invention discloses a mixed refuse combustion waste heat power generation system which comprises a drier, an extruding, chopping and heating device, a cooling tower, a mixer and power generation equipment, wherein a steam outlet, a water inlet and a feed opening are formed in the power generation equipment; heating pipes are arranged on the drier and the extruding, chopping and heating device respectively; the steam outlet is connected with the heating pipes through pipelines respectively; the cooling tower is connected with the water inlet through a pipeline; a conveying belt is arranged between the drier and the extruding, chopping and heating device; another conveying belt is arranged between the extruding, chopping and heating device and the mixer; vertically moving hydraulic cylinders are mounted at the lower parts of hanging frames; and a driven extruding plate and a cutter plate are mounted at the lower part of the vertically moving hydraulic cylinders respectively. Through the mixed refuse combustion waste heat power generation system, waste heat produced during a power generation process can be utilized more efficiently, household refuse and coal can be mixed for use, the treatment cost of household refuse is reduced, and the consumption of coal is reduced; and meanwhile, the system is low in investment cost and is more environmentally friendly.
